Art Deco Dancer Sculpture in Copper by Henri Lautier Cast by Robert Thew

Art Deco Dancer Sculpture in Copper by Henri Lautier Cast by Robert Thew

By Henri Lautier

Located in Philadelphia, PA

This listing is for a Classic and striking Art Deco copper sculpture depicting a dancing nude by Henri Lautier who was a French Sculpture. The sculpture stands at approx 12.25 inches tall, 6" wide, and 6" deep. The figure is mounted on a round copper base. The underside of the base is marked with the year 1928 and the initials of the foundry G. Thew, for Robert Garrett Thew. The condition of the piece is very nice, with no damage, and a great patina on the copper which only age will produce. Robert Garrett Thew (1892-1964) was born in Sharon, CT and studied at Syracuse University under Edward Penfield (1866-1925), Walter Biggs...

Art Deco Pochoir Fashion Prints Le Retour by Georges Barbier and Petrole Hahn

Art Deco Pochoir Fashion Prints Le Retour by Georges Barbier and Petrole Hahn

By George Barbier

Located in Tustin, CA

Collectible antique Art Deco hand-colored (pochoir) fashion plate image entitled “Le Retour" by one of the greatest designers and illustrators, Georges Barbier (1892-1932). Le Retour is signed GB 1923. Barbier is known as one of the leading figures in the birth of the Art Deco style and renowned for his exquisite illustrations that capture the mood, fashion and atmosphere of the roaring twenties. Le Retour depicts a male warrior wearing a winged helmet and holding a spear. A woman leans on his shoulder and the two stand on a rocky outcrop before a fire.
